Comfort

After your teeth separators (brackets) are placed, you may experience discomfort or pain from the forces exerted on your mouth. It’s normal for lips and gums to take some getting used to this force, but eventually it will lessen as confidence grows with your smile. To help with this discomfort, try placing orthodontic wax over any wire that pokes you or causes cheek discomfort.
